Storm使用方法详解:从入门到精通的必经之路
Storm是一个开源的分布式实时计算系统,用于处理大数据流。在开始使用Storm之前,你需要先了解Storm的基本概念和使用场景。接下来,让我们开始详细介绍Storm的使用方法。
1. 安装Storm集群
首先,你需要在你的系统中安装Storm集群。你可以从Storm官网下载最新的Storm版本并按照官方文档进行安装。安装完成后,你需要配置Storm的配置文件(storm.yaml),包括设置ZooKeeper的地址等。
2. 编写Storm拓扑(Topology)
Storm的主要任务是处理数据,因此你需要编写一个拓扑来处理数据。拓扑是一个计算任务,可以接收数据并执行一系列操作。你可以使用Java或Clojure等语言编写拓扑。下面是一个简单的Java拓扑示例:
public class WordCountTopology {
public static void main(String[] args) {
LocalCluster cluster = new LocalCluster(); // 创建本地集群实例
TopologyBuilder builder = new TopologyBuilder(); // 创建拓扑构建器实例
builder.setSpout("spout", new RandomSentenceSpout(), 3); // 设置数据源组件,随机生成单词流
builder.setBolt("count", new WordCountBolt(), 8) // 设置计算组件,统计单词数量并输出到下游组件或数据库等存储介质中。
栏 目:Storm
本文地址:http://www.ziyuanwuyou.com/html/dashuju/Storm/7468.html
您可能感兴趣的文章
- 12-21Storm使用方法详解:从入门到精通的必经之路
- 12-21一文读懂Storm的使用方法,轻松驾驭大数据世界
- 12-21数据处理新姿势:用Storm实现高效的数据可视化分析。
- 12-21掌握Storm的核心功能和使用方法,轻松应对大数据挑战
- 12-21Storm实战手册:带你领略数据处理的魅力与技巧
- 12-21从入门到高级应用,Storm使用方法的全面指南
- 12-21如何利用Storm进行高效的数据清洗和整合?
- 12-21新手也能快速上手Storm,一篇文章解决所有疑惑
- 12-21数据处理利器Storm,一篇文章带你玩转使用方法
- 12-21Storm实战应用指南,带你领略数据处理的魅力世界!
阅读排行
推荐教程
- 12-21零基础也能学会Storm的使用方法!快来看看吧!
- 12-21从入门到精通:Storm使用方法的全面解读!
- 12-21初学者也能快速掌握Storm的使用方法!
- 12-21数据处理新姿势:Storm使用方法详解!
- 12-21Storm实战应用指南,带你领略数据处理的魅力世界!
- 12-21一文搞定Storm使用方法,数据处理从此无忧!
- 12-21Storm新手教程:快速上手数据可视化分析!
- 12-21Storm使用心得分享,让数据处理变得更简单!
- 12-21如何最大化利用Storm进行数据处理?一篇文章告诉你答案!
- 12-21一文读懂Storm的使用方法,轻松驾驭大数据世界